Double Layer PCB hukumar

Allon mai fuska biyu yana da wayoyi a duka ɓangarorin biyu Amma don amfani da ɓangarorin biyu na waya, dole ne ya zama akwai haɗin lantarki mai dacewa tsakanin ɓangarorin biyu.Wannan "gada" tsakanin da'irar ana kiranta ramin jagora (VIA) .Ramin jagora shine karamin rami a cikin PCB, wanda aka cika ko an rufe shi da karfe, ana iya haɗa shi da waya a bangarorin biyu.Saboda bangarori biyu suna da sau biyu na yanki guda ɗaya, kuma saboda ana iya haɗa wayoyi (wanda zai iya rauni a kusa da wani gefen), ya fi dacewa da da'irar da ke da rikitarwa fiye da rukuni guda.

Haihuwar kwamitin kewaye da yawa

Densityara yawan kunshin IC yana haifar da babban haɗin haɗin kai, wanda ke buƙatar amfani da abubuwa da yawa.Matsalolin ƙirar da ba a zata ba kamar su amo, ƙarfin ɓatacciyar hanya, crosstalk sun bayyana a cikin shimfidar wuraren da aka buga .Saboda haka, ƙirar PCB dole ne a nufin ragewa. tsayin layin sigina da gujewa hanyoyin layi daya.Bayanin, a cikin rukuni guda, ko ma a cikin rukuni biyu, waɗannan buƙatun ba za a iya amsa su da gamsarwa ba saboda iyakance adadin hanyoyin wucewa da za a iya aiwatarwa. Game da adadi mai yawa na haɗin juna da bukatun giciye, dole ne a fadada rukunin kwamatin zuwa sama da matakai biyu don samun gamsassun ayyuka.Saboda haka, babban dalilin allon zagaye na bangarori daban-daban shine samar da karin 'yanci ga hadaddun da / ko hayaniya masu saurin layin lantarki don zabar dacewa Hanyoyi masu wayoyi Wurin kewayawa na multilayer yana da a kalla yadudduka masu gudanar da aiki guda uku, biyu daga cikinsu suna da shimfidar waje, kuma sauran zangon shine an haɗa shi a cikin jirgi mai ɗaukar hoto Haɗin wutar lantarki tsakanin su yawanci ana yin ta ne ta hanyar sanyawa ta cikin ramuka a ɓangaren giciye na kwamitin zagaye.Miltilayer buga allon zagaye, kamar bangarori biyu, gabaɗaya an sanya su ta hanyar - faranti masu kyau sai dai in an nuna hakan.

Ana yin Multilaminates ne ta hanyar sanya layuka biyu ko sama da haka na da'ira akan juna, tare da amintattun hanyoyin da aka riga aka saita tsakanin su. Tunda ana yin hakowa da kuma sanya wutar lantarki kafin a dunkule dukkannin layukan, wannan dabarar ta keta tsarin masana'antar gargajiya tun daga farko .Latunan biyu na ciki sun hada da bangarori biyu na gargajiya, yayin da na waje kuma an yi su da bangarori daban daban. Kafin a birgima, za a fara amfani da faranti na ciki, a sanya shi ta cikin ramuka, a sauya shi ta hanyar zane, a ci gaba kuma a sanya shi. Launin ramin shine layin siginar, wanda aka zana ta wata hanyar da zata samar da madaidaicin zoben jan ƙarfe a gefen gefen ramin.Sannan sai a mirgine yadudduka don samar da yawa na abubuwan maye, wanda za'a iya haɗa su ta raƙuman ruwa.

Mayila za a iya yin aikin a cikin matattarar ruwa ko kuma a cikin ɗakunan matsi (autoclave) .A cikin matattarar na'ura, an sanya kayan da aka shirya (don matattarar matsi) a ƙarƙashin sanyi ko preheated matsa lamba (kayan da zazzabin gilashin gilashin gilashi ya sanya a 170-180 ° C) .Girman zafin gilashin shine yanayin zafin da yankin amorphous na polymer (resin) ko wani sashi na polymer mai kyan gani yake canzawa daga mawuyacin hali, mai saurin rauni zuwa yanayin ruɓaɓɓe, na jihar roba.

Ana amfani da masu amfani da yawa a cikin kayan aikin lantarki na musamman (kwakwalwa, kayan aikin soja), musamman ma a yanayi na nauyi da nauyin da ya wuce kima.Duk da haka, ana iya samun wannan ta hanyar ƙara farashin laminates a musayar ƙarin sarari da ƙasa da nauyi. saurin da'irori, laminates suma suna da matukar amfani yayin da suke samar da masu zane na allon zagaye da katako sama da biyu na katako don wayoyi da samar da manyan yankuna na kasa da karfi.
